deductible (diduk´t n 1. a stipulated sum the covered person must pay toward the cost of dental treatment before the benefits of the program go into effect. The deductible may be annual or payable only once and may vary in amount from program to program. n 2. the amount of dental expense for which the beneficiary is responsible before a third party will assume any liability for payment of benefits. Deductible may be an annual or one-time charge and may vary in amount from program to program. See also family deductible. deductible amount, n the portion of dental care expense the insured must pay before the plan's benefits begin. deductible clause, n a provision in an insurance contract stipulating that the insurer will pay only that amount that is in excess of a specified amount. |
